2. Thay đổi về tuần hoàn, hô hấp và một số tác dụng không mong muốn Gây tê cạnh cột sông ngực ít gây ảnh hưởng tới tuần hoan hơn so với

gây tê ngoai mang cứng (trong va sau mổ):

- Nhóm gây tê NMC có HATB thấp hơn nhóm CCSN tại 1 sô thời điểm, đặc biệt thời điểm sau bolus thuôc gây tê 15 phút của nhóm NMC thấp hơn nhóm CCSN có ý nghĩa thông kê với p < 0,01: trong mổ (65,9 ± 5,7 mmHg so với 68,6 ± 6,2 mmHg) va sau mổ (68,2 ± 3,6 mmHg so với 71,8 ± 8,6 mmHg).

- Tỉ lệ bệnh nhân bị tụt huyết áp của nhóm CCSN thấp hơn nhóm NMC (5% so với 15%).

Không có sự khác biệt giữa nhóm gây tê CCSN va nhóm gây tê NMC về hô hấp.

Tỉ lệ một sô tác dụng không mong muôn khi gây tê CCSN bằng hỗn hợp levobupivacain – fentanyl thấp, không gặp tai biến hoặc biến chứng nguy hiểm, tỉ lệ nay khác biệt không có ý nghĩa thông kê so với gây tê NMC (p >

0,05): buồn nôn va nôn (7,5% so với 12,5%); ngứa (10,0% so với 15,0%); run (12,5% so với 15,0%) va bí tiểu (7,5% so với 15,0%) tương ứng hai nhóm.

KIÊN NGHỊ

1. Có thể áp dụng phương pháp gây tê cạnh cột sông ngực dưới hướng dẫn của siêu âm bằng hỗn hợp levobupivacain 0,125% kết hợp fentanyl 2 μg/ml cho phẫu thuật lồng ngực một bên ở trẻ em.

2. Tiếp tục có những nghiên cứu thêm với cỡ mẫu lớn hơn va trên trẻ em dưới 3 tuổi về hiệu quả va tính an toan của gây tê cạnh cột sông ngực dưới hướng dẫn của siêu âm cho các phẫu thuật khác nhau.
